Case History Conversation



As we explore your case history throughout the SMILE Eye Surgical treatment consultation, we intend to collect essential details to ensure the most effective possible result for your procedure. Your case history provides vital understandings into any type of pre-existing conditions, medications you're presently taking, and previous eye surgical treatments or therapies. Comprehending https://www.thatsmags.com/shanghai/post/33280/shanghai-jiahui-international-hospital-appoints-dr-jun-li-as-chief-of-surgery enables us to customize the SMILE procedure to your specific demands and minimize any dangers connected with the surgical treatment.

During this conversation, we'll ask you concerning any persistent diseases such as diabetic issues or high blood pressure, as these can affect your eye wellness and the healing process post-surgery. It is essential to educate us regarding any kind of allergic reactions you may have, specifically to medications or anesthetic. Additionally, divulging any background of eye conditions like glaucoma or cataracts helps us prepare the surgery successfully.
